About Darien, GA's

Darien, located in McIntosh County, Georgia, is a historic city founded in 1736. It is the second oldest planned city in the state and was originally established as a military outpost due to its strategic location along the Atlantic coast. Darien's history is marked by its involvement in various colonial and Civil War conflicts, making it a site of significant historical interest. The city's layout reflects the original plans from the colonial era, and it remains a small, but culturally rich community.

Local Attractions in Darien, GA

Fort King George Historic Site - A well-preserved colonial fort offering insights into early 18th-century military life.

Darien Waterfront Park - A scenic area with views of the Darien River, ideal for picnics and leisure activities.

Old Jail Art Center & Museum - Exhibits local art and historical artifacts, housed in the city's historic jail.

Sapelo Island National Estuarine Research Reserve - A nearby reserve that features rich biodiversity and offers guided tours.

Tabby Ruins - Remnants of colonial-era structures made from a type of concrete made from oyster shells, reflecting the early building methods.


The Economy of Darien, GA

Darien's economy historically relied heavily on the timber and seafood industries, particularly shrimping, which continues to be a significant economic activity today. The city has also seen growth in tourism, driven by its rich history and natural beauty, including access to coastal waters and marshlands. Local businesses, including restaurants and shops, benefit from both the tourist influx and the local seafood industry.
